What is Etsy UK

Etsy is an online marketplace that specializes in handmade, vintage, and unique factory-manufactured items. Founded in 2005, Etsy has grown into a global platform where artisans, crafters, and collectors can connect with buyers seeking distinctive goods. Unlike traditional e-commerce platforms, Etsy UK focuses on fostering a community of independent sellers who create personalized and often customizable products.

Key Features of Etsy UK

  1. Handmade Products: Etsy UK is renowned for its wide range of handmade items crafted by artisans around the world. These can include jewelry, clothing, home decor, art, and much more, each reflecting the unique style and creativity of the seller.
  2. Vintage Items: In addition to handmade goods, Etsy UK also features vintage items that are at least 20 years old. Vintage enthusiasts can find everything from clothing and accessories to home furnishings and collectibles, offering a glimpse into past eras.
  3. Supplies for Crafting: Etsy UK serves as a marketplace not only for finished products but also for craft supplies. Sellers offer a variety of materials, tools, and kits that enable buyers to embark on their own creative projects.
  4. Global Community: Etsy UK connects sellers and buyers from around the globe, creating a diverse marketplace where cultural influences and artistic traditions converge. This global reach allows sellers to showcase their craftsmanship to a wide audience of potential buyers.

How Etsy Works

  • Seller Accounts: Individuals or small businesses can open a shop on Etsy UK to showcase their products. Sellers set up their shop, list items for sale, and manage their inventory and orders through Etsy's platform.
  • Search and Discovery: Buyers can browse Etsy's extensive catalog using search filters such as keywords, categories, price ranges, and more. Etsy's algorithm also recommends products based on browsing history and preferences.
  • Community and Support: Etsy UK emphasizes community engagement through forums, seller meetups, and support resources like the Etsy Seller Handbook. This community-oriented approach encourages collaboration, knowledge sharing, and growth among sellers.

Setting Up Shop: A Seller's Guide

If you're looking to sell on Etsy UK, setting up your shop is the next logical step. Click on "Sell on Etsy" and follow the prompts to open your shop. Choose a catchy and descriptive shop name that resonates with your products and target audience. Etsy UK allows you to list a variety of items, including handmade crafts, vintage goods, and craft supplies. Each listing should include clear, high-quality photos and detailed descriptions to attract potential buyers.

Understanding Etsy UK's Search and Discovery Features

Etsy UK's search and discovery features are designed to help buyers find exactly what they're looking for. Utilize relevant keywords in your product titles and descriptions to improve visibility in search results. Tags also play a crucial role—choose tags that accurately describe your items and use all available tag spaces to maximize exposure. Buyers can filter their searches by category, price range, and location, making it easier to narrow down their options.

Promoting Your Etsy UK Shop

Promoting your Etsy UK shop is essential for attracting new customers and driving sales. Take advantage of social media plat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and Pinterest to showcase your products and engage with your target audience. Consider running promotions or offering discounts to encourage repeat purchases and word-of-mouth referrals. Etsy UK also offers advertising options to increase visibility through promoted listings and Google Shopping campaigns.
